Description & Requirements

For our Global Technology department in London, we are looking to hire a:

IT Support Engineer

Global Technology @ Berenberg

In an era where digitalization and modern IT infrastructure is revolutionizing banking, we are shaping a technology-driven bank in which you as an IT professional will work closely with our business units. Our technology teams offer you an environment that will present you with exciting challenges - be it through the support and further development of legacy systems or the introduction of modern technologies such as AI, machine learning and highly automated trading applications.

Your Role in the team:

In this role, the Support Engineer will diagnose Software/Hardware to a technical fix solution result. This could either be over the phone, remote or in person at the desk. You'll cover one or more areas of expertise, assist with Upgrades & Fixes when required. The ideal candidate will have extensive knowledge of Citrix, Windows OS, Office365, Intune, Fidessa, Bloomberg, Cisco Telephony and some basic network knowledge.

What will you do:

  • Act as an internal ‘Technical Support Technician’ for all IT Workplace related support, working across a broad range of technologies and liaising across multiple areas of the business to support incidents, problems, and requests. Responsible for answering IT requests via Tickets in ServiceNow, phone, email, live chat, or instant message and explaining solutions in technical and non-technical terms.
  • Successfully support the business (onsite, phone, and remote) with comprehensive issue resolutions.
  • Provide IT support at offsite conferences.
  • Perform administrative tasks in IT Systems.
  • Participate in IT Projects (e.g. Mobile Device Migration Projects).

What we are looking for:

  • Committed and client-oriented, proactive in providing excellent customer service.
  • Proven experience/support with Windows Server, WIN10/7, Group Policy, Active Directory, Citrix XenApp, UMS Admin, Mobile Devices (Apple), MAC support, Intune Admin, Telephony, Azure experience, printers, thin clients (HP & IGEL), desk setup, Bloomberg, Fidessa, Microsoft Office, Uniflow Print Server, IPC & Cisco Telephony.
  • Knowledge of LAN, WAN and WIFI networks and technologies as well as leased lines.
  • Effective time management including ability to multi-task, organize and prioritize daily business as well as IT Projects.
  • Experience in supporting users within an Investment Bank environment would be helpful.
  • Good communication skills and the ability to work under pressure to meet challenging deadlines.
  • Flexibility for occasional weekend work and out of hours support, willingness to travel to support for Berenberg Conference(s).

What we offer you:

  • Private pension plan - 10% of base salary contribution by Berenberg.
  • Generous 30-day holiday allowance.
  • Private Health Insurance.
  • Life Insurance scheme.
  • Flexible working hours.
  • Enhanced parental leave policies.
  • Employee Assistance Programme offering counselling sessions related to mental health, financial wellbeing and other topics.
